I can point out that cables communication [1] is designed to withstand most of the threats discussed in this thread. For instance, it works over Tor, and I doubt that Mexican drug cartels have access to this network's global traffic analysis system, if such exists. But I am skeptical wrt. ability of activists and journalists to rationally assess the vulnerability of communication methods that they use, even when provided with necessary information.
